~openerp-dev/openerp-tools/trunk

« back to all changes in this revision

Viewing changes to openerp-runbot/openerprunbot/core.py

  • Committer: Openerp Online
  • Date: 2011-11-16 19:28:42 UTC
  • Revision ID: online@openerp.com-20111116192842-i0yiky57z0kav0zq
Add command-line option to let us specify a starting job-id.

Show diffs side-by-side

added added

removed removed

Lines of Context:
661
661
 
662
662
class RunBot(object):
663
663
    """Used as a singleton, to manage almost all the Runbot state and logic."""
664
 
    def __init__(self, wd, poll, server_net_port, server_xml_port, client_web_port,  number, nginx_port, domain, test, workers):
 
664
    def __init__(self, wd, poll, server_net_port, server_xml_port,
 
665
        client_web_port,  number, nginx_port, domain, test, workers,
 
666
        current_job_id):
665
667
        self.wd=wd
666
668
        self.sleeptime=20 if openerprunbot.debug else int(poll)
667
669
        self.server_net_port=int(server_net_port)
678
680
        self.allocated_port = 0
679
681
        self.jobs = {}
680
682
        self.last_lp_call = None
681
 
        self.current_job_id = 0
 
683
        self.current_job_id = current_job_id
682
684
        self.manual_build_count = 0
683
685
 
684
686
    def registered_teams(self):